## Sensor drift: what to do at 3am

If the GrowLoop controller starts reporting humidity swings that don't match the backup probes in the Fernwick greenhouse, it's almost always sensor drift, not an actual climate event. Don't panic and don't touch the vents manually. First, restart the calibration daemon and give it ten minutes to re-baseline. If readings still disagree by more than 5%, flip the controller into safe mode. The safe-mode thresholds it will use are these.

config for yahap-bajof:
[istix]
host = istix.qorvelsys.internal
user = istix_svc
database = istix_prod

Subject: Handover of the cron drift investigation

Hi,

As discussed, I'm rotating off the Pendrel cron drift investigation ahead of the Q3 freeze. Current state: we've confirmed clock skew on two worker pools, ruled out NTP misconfiguration, and narrowed the remaining drift to the Larkspur hypervisor layer. All findings, timelines, and reproduction steps are documented in the investigation log. Effective Monday, responsibility transfers to the engineer named below.

account owner for bawip-tahag: Raleth Quenok

Handover — PingPatient reminder job

Hey, quick brain dump before I'm off. PingPatient runs hourly and nudges folks about upcoming visits at the Brambleton Health Centre. It's mostly stable, but watch the timezone handling — daylight saving transitions have bitten us twice. The dedupe cache lives in Redis and expires after 72 hours, so don't panic if you see repeat sends after a flush. For the release manager: next deploy needs the new template bundle. Any release blockers should be escalated to the contact below.

account owner for fajep-yagef: Kasix Eliiel

## Authentication

Migraplane applies schema changes in expand-contract phases so the Ledgerline API stays up throughout. Contractors run migrations through the Migraplane control service, never directly against the database. Each run must be authenticated; the control service rejects anonymous calls outright. Use the internal service key provided below for all staging migration runs.

service key, bajep-hahig: zpat15_8GdlyV2kd9BCqYH